Output e96ced93f4cd1a91632eff12437f0608fe805c5eded0b45c635d60a1998376fa: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ce6f5a644a09872de91a973c99281a7985d514 OP_EQUAL
address
3QC1T62L1SbrBdkktdnrj9RnqV7NYexhrD
transaction
e96ced93f4cd1a91632eff12437f0608fe805c5eded0b45c635d60a1998376fa
spent
true